A water purifier is a consumable device wearing a permanent-looking case. Everything that makes it work — the sediment cartridge, the carbon, the membrane if it has one, the post-filter — is designed to be used up and thrown away. “Water purifier” covers several quite different machines, and the service scope differs with each:
| Unit type | What gets replaced | What else the service covers |
|---|---|---|
| Countertop or faucet-mounted filter | A single cartridge, usually sediment plus carbon in one body | Clean the housing and the diverter; check the tap connection |
| Under-sink multi-stage (no RO) | Sediment and carbon cartridges, on their own intervals | Sanitise housings; check the dedicated tap and all connections; test flow |
| Under-sink RO system | Pre-filters, post-filter, and the membrane on a longer cycle | Check the waste line and its ratio, the storage tank pressure, and sanitise the tank |
| Hot-and-cold dispenser | Its filter set, per the manufacturer | Descale where applicable; sanitise the internal tanks; check the drip tray drain and the electrical supply |
| Whole-house outdoor filter | Media, not cartridges — a different job entirely | Backwash function, bypass valve and drain run — see our filtration installation guide |

A whole-house outdoor “master” filter sits at the point the mains enters the property and protects the plumbing and appliances; a drinking purifier sits at one tap and treats what you drink. They are not alternatives and one does not service the other — see water filtration installation for the outdoor unit.
Manufacturers publish cartridge life in litres, and then everybody converts it into months because months are easier to remember. That conversion assumes an average household. Yours may not be one.
Two homes with identical units can be a long way apart. A household of six drinking and cooking from the tap puts several times the volume through the unit that a couple does. Incoming water quality moves it further: sediment loading varies across the Klang Valley, and it rises sharply after mains work, a supply interruption or a burst in the area, when disturbed sediment reaches every tap downstream. A week of that can consume a meaningful share of a sediment cartridge’s life.
So treat the published month figure as a default and adjust it on evidence. Flow dropping is the clearest signal that the sediment stage is loading up. A returning taste or smell says the carbon is spent. A visible change in the cartridge when it is removed tells you whether you were early or late, which is why it is worth actually looking at the old one rather than letting it go straight into the bin. The micron rating printed on a cartridge tells you what it is designed to catch — the lower the number, the finer the filter and, all else equal, the sooner it loads — but no rating extends the life of a cartridge that is full.
The one interval not to stretch is carbon. A saturated carbon cartridge does not politely stop working; under continued use it can release some of what it previously captured. Late is genuinely worse than nothing here.
Reverse osmosis units have a component the others do not, and it changes the service. The membrane is the fine barrier that does the actual work, it costs more than a cartridge, and it runs on a longer cycle — typically several cartridge changes to one membrane.
Three things protect it and all three are service items. First, the pre-filters: they exist to keep sediment and chlorine off the membrane, and skipping them shortens membrane life sharply. A household that stretches pre-filter changes to save money ends up buying membranes, which is the more expensive part. Second, the waste line: an RO unit sends a proportion of feed water to drain, and that line must actually run to drain freely. A kinked, blocked or badly tied waste line is one of the most common under-sink faults there is, and it presents as poor production or as a unit that runs continuously. Third, the storage tank, where the unit has one: its pressure and its internal cleanliness both matter, and the tank is a place biofilm is happy to live.
A TDS meter is the usual way a technician demonstrates that a membrane is still doing its job — a reading before and after the unit. Treat it as a comparison rather than a verdict: what matters is the difference between feed and product, and the trend across services, not a single number. And note what it cannot tell you: TDS says nothing about microbiological quality, which is why sanitising is a separate step.
| Symptom | Most likely cause | What it needs |
|---|---|---|
| Flow has slowed at the purifier tap | Sediment stage loaded, or a kinked line | Change the sediment cartridge; check the tubing runs |
| Taste or smell has come back | Carbon spent | Change the carbon — do not stretch this one |
| Water looks cloudy or has fine particles | New cartridge not flushed, or a failed cartridge | Flush through; if it persists, inspect the cartridge |
| An RO unit produces very little, or runs constantly | Waste line, tank pressure, or a spent membrane | Check the waste line and tank first, then test the membrane |
| Damp, staining or swollen board in the cabinet below | A weeping connection, tap or waste line | Stop and find the leak before anything else |
| A hot-and-cold dispenser has become slow or noisy | Scale, or a loaded filter set | Descale and change the filter set per the manufacturer |
| Nothing wrong, but no service in over a year | Overdue by volume, whatever it tastes like | Service it — taste is a late indicator, not an early one |
The row worth acting on immediately is the damp cabinet. Everything else on this list is water quality; that one is property damage in progress.
Filter housings, tubing and storage tanks are dark, permanently wet and at room temperature, which is an excellent environment for biofilm. It forms slowly and invisibly, and once it is established, every new cartridge you fit is installed into it.
This is why a cartridge swap on its own is not a service. Sanitising means cleaning the housings and, on units with a storage tank, treating the tank, then flushing everything thoroughly before the unit goes back into use. It is not a difficult step; it is simply the one that takes time, and the one an under-priced service visit drops first. Ask directly whether it is included, because the difference between the two visits is invisible on the day and considerable over years.
A unit that has stood unused for a long period — a holiday, a vacant rental, a unit between tenants — needs sanitising and a full flush before it is trusted again, regardless of when its cartridges were last changed. Stagnant water in a purifier is a worse starting point than mains water. The same applies after any supply interruption that let the system drain down.
The most expensive thing a purifier does is leak. It sits inside a cabinet, on a board that is often not designed to get wet, with the leak hidden behind whatever is stored in front of it. A weep at a push-fit connection can run for weeks before anyone opens the cupboard, and by then the base panel has swollen and the carcass edge has started to delaminate. A large share of Malaysian purifiers are on rental or instalment plans that bundle servicing, and the servicing is often the real reason the plan is worth having — or the reason it is not. Establish, in writing:
On an owned unit you carry the schedule yourself, which is cheaper and more flexible but only works if somebody actually tracks it. A note in a calendar with the cartridge model numbers on it is the entire system, and it is the difference between servicing on volume and servicing on memory. The corpus publishes figures for the filtration work around a purifier rather than for the service visit itself, and those are the honest anchors. Our water filtration installation guide puts an annual media change and service at RM200–RM600, and fitting an under-sink drinking filter at RM150–RM500 for labour on a single kitchen tap. Install-only labour where you supply the unit is RM300–RM800, and a whole-house outdoor master filter is RM1,500–RM3,500 supply-and-install — useful context if the conversation turns out to be about protecting the whole property rather than one tap.

| Deliverable | Why it matters |
|---|---|
| A written record of which cartridges were replaced | Stage and model, so the next service is not guesswork |
| The date each remaining stage is next due | Not all stages come due together; a blanket “next year” hides that |
| Confirmation that housings were sanitised | The step most likely to have been skipped |
| Membrane status, where the unit has one | Tested and reported, not assumed |
| Confirmation every connection was pressure-checked | The leak is the expensive failure, not the taste |
| The old cartridges shown to you before disposal | Proof the work happened, and evidence on whether the interval is right |
| Flow and, on RO units, a before-and-after reading | A trend across services is worth more than any single figure |
Common mistakes worth avoiding: stretching the carbon interval to save money, servicing on the calendar while household usage has doubled, skipping pre-filters on an RO unit and then buying a membrane early, buying a unit with proprietary cartridges without checking what they cost to replace, leaving a unit unused for months and putting it straight back into service, and storing cleaning products hard against the connections so the first drip is never seen.
